
Fresh fruit salad doesn't get more charming than this — hollowed apple halves become edible bowls packed with a jewel-bright mix of diced apples, pear, blueberries, and strawberries. The dressing is where things really sing: bright lime juice, raw honey, freshly grated ginger, and a whisper of Ceylon cinnamon come together into something that tastes far more sophisticated than the short ingredient list suggests. A quick ten-minute rest lets the flavors meld and coaxes a little natural juice out of the fruit, turning the whole thing into something almost syrupy and irresistible. Every single component here is naturally free of wheat and gluten — no swaps needed, no label-checking required, just whole fruit and pantry staples doing their thing. The apple cups themselves are a clever trick: brushing the cut edges with lime juice keeps them from browning while adding another layer of citrus brightness. Halve 4 apples crosswise (through the equator, not stem to base) to create 8 cup-shaped halves. Use a melon baller or small spoon to scoop out the core and enough flesh to form a shallow bowl, leaving a wall about 1/2 inch thick. Brush the cut surfaces and interior of each cup with 1 tbsp lime juice to prevent browning, then set aside on a serving platter.
In a small bowl, whisk together the 2 tbsp lime juice, honey, grated ginger, ground Ceylon cinnamon, and lime zest until the honey is fully dissolved and the dressing is smooth.
